Jan Boterberg, the respected referee, stands at the center of a growing storm as the crowd holds its collective breath. His quick decision-making is under scrutiny on the vast, green canvas of the pitch. The atmosphere grows tense as he assesses whether Kayembe has committed a critical foul in the box.

The fans watch fervently as the scene unfolds. Kayembe’s robust defense appears clean at first glance, but Petris, with an almost theatrical flair, seems to have entangled himself, hoping for a favorable verdict. The eyes of thousands flicker between the pitch and the giant screen, eager for the outcome.

Boterberg’s decisive nod declares it: no penalty, no infringement. The murmur of anticipation crescendos into a roar of relief from one half of the stadium. Meanwhile, the supporters holding their breath for a penalty deflate in unison.

But tension does not dissipate so easily. The linemen’s glances and the referees’ hushed discussion introduce another layer of suspense—was there perhaps an offside? A brief replay examination reveals nothing askew. The verdict stands: the goal is valid.

This seemingly minor match detail escalates into a dramatic turning point. Rik De Mil, the beleaguered coach pacing along the sidelines, embodies indignation. The Role of Referee Decisions in Football

1. Decisions Under Pressure: Referees regularly face immense pressure to make swift decisions. Their role is critical in maintaining the integrity of the game, especially in situations laden with tension and potential controversy. According to a study in the International Journal of Sports Science and Coaching, the pressure on referees during high-stakes matches can lead to widely varied perceptions from fans and pundits alike.

2. Use of Technology: Modern football increasingly relies on technology, such as VAR (Video Assistant Referee), to aid in making accurate decisions. In the situation described with Boterberg, while technology did not highlight any errors, the collective anticipation from the crowd underscored the evolving dynamics between human judgment and technological support.
